It is an evidence-based therapy that helps people understand and change long-standing patterns of thinking, feeling and behaving that may be contributing to ongoing emotional difficulties. These patterns, known as schemas, often develop during childhood or adolescence and can continue to influence relationships, self-esteem, coping strategies and mental health throughout adulthood.
Schemas are deeply held beliefs about ourselves, others and the world around us. For example, a person may develop beliefs such as "I'm not good enough", "People will leave me", or "My needs don't matter". While these beliefs may have developed as a way of coping with difficult experiences, they can become unhelpful and continue to create challenges later in life.
Schema Therapy helps you identify these patterns, understand where they came from, and develop healthier ways of responding to life's challenges. It combines elements of Cognitive Behavioural Therapy, attachment theory and experiential techniques to create lasting emotional change.
This approach can help treat a range of mental health concerns, including anxiety, depression, relationship difficulties, personality disorders, eating disorders, trauma-related difficulties, low self-esteem and emotional regulation challenges.
